v3.25.1
Financing transaction (Additional Information) (Details)
$ / shares in Units, $ in Thousands
3 Months Ended
Nov. 08, 2023
USD ($)
Days
Segment
$ / shares
shares
Mar. 31, 2025
USD ($)
Warrants
$ / shares
Dec. 31, 2024
$ / shares
Mar. 18, 2024
$ / shares
Dec. 31, 2023
$ / shares
shares
Subsidiary or Equity Method Investee [Line Items]          
Common stock, par value | $ / shares   $ 0.0001 $ 0.0001 $ 0.0001  
Advance condition The Company’s right to request Advances is conditioned upon the Company achieving a minimum of one new passenger auto-original equipment manufacturer (“OEM”) or commercial OEM program award with at least a 50,000 unit volume        
Program award 1 | Segment 50,000        
Trading price of the common stock $ 15        
Subscription Agreements [Member]          
Subsidiary or Equity Method Investee [Line Items]          
Aggregate shares available for purchase | shares 7,360,460        
Common stock, par value | $ / shares $ 0.0001        
Share price | $ / shares $ 2.9        
Proceeds from issuance of common stock $ 21,400        
Standby Equity Purchase Agreement [Member]          
Subsidiary or Equity Method Investee [Line Items]          
Share price | $ / shares $ 10,000        
Preferred stock liquidation preference per share | $ / shares $ 12,000        
Percentage of dividend payble 7.00%        
Convertible preferred stock nonredeemable or redeemable issuer option value $ 10,000        
Common stock applicable conversion price 250.00%        
Facility fee   $ 2,500      
Origination fee   600      
Administrative fees expense   300      
Fees and expenses of the investor and its counsel   $ 400      
Standby Equity Purchase Agreement [Member] | Series A One [Member]          
Subsidiary or Equity Method Investee [Line Items]          
Warrants issued | shares         3,000,000
Standby Equity Purchase Agreement [Member] | Preferred Stock [Member]          
Subsidiary or Equity Method Investee [Line Items]          
Total preferred facility $ 125,000        
Standby Equity Purchase Agreement [Member] | Common Stock [Member]          
Subsidiary or Equity Method Investee [Line Items]          
Percentage of common stock beneficially owned by investor 19.90%        
Standby Equity Purchase Agreement [Member] | Common Stock [Member] | Series A One [Member]          
Subsidiary or Equity Method Investee [Line Items]          
Warrants issued to purchase shares of common stock, Exercise price | $ / shares         $ 5
Number of warrants outstanding | Warrants | Warrants   3,000,000      
Percentage of common stock outstanding   19.90%      
Standby Equity Purchase Agreement [Member] | Maximum [Member]          
Subsidiary or Equity Method Investee [Line Items]          
Debt instrument convertible threshold trading days | Days 30        
Standby Equity Purchase Agreement [Member] | Maximum [Member] | Preferred Stock [Member]          
Subsidiary or Equity Method Investee [Line Items]          
Number of shares preferred stock aggregate value $ 50,000        
Standby Equity Purchase Agreement [Member] | Minimum [Member]          
Subsidiary or Equity Method Investee [Line Items]          
Debt instrument convertible threshold trading days | Days 20        
Standby Equity Purchase Agreement [Member] | Minimum [Member] | Preferred Stock [Member]          
Subsidiary or Equity Method Investee [Line Items]          
Number of shares preferred stock aggregate value $ 25,000